Jimi Hendrix is widely regarded as one of the greatest guitarists of all time, known for his innovative playing style and electrifying performances. His iconic image often includes him setting his guitar on fire, a move that has become synonymous with his name. The act of burning his guitar was not just a spectacle for the audience, but a symbolic gesture that represented something deeper for Hendrix.

For Hendrix, burning his guitar was like a sacrifice. It was a way for him to show his dedication and passion for his music, as well as a way to release his emotions and energy on stage. The guitar was not just a tool for him, but an extension of himself, a part of his identity. By setting it ablaze, he was making a statement about the intensity and power of his music, as well as his willingness to push boundaries and break free from convention.

In an interview, Hendrix once said, “You sacrifice the things you love. I love my guitar.” This statement speaks to the deep connection he had with his instrument, and the lengths he was willing to go to in order to create his art. Hendrix was known for his wild and unpredictable performances, and burning his guitar was just one example of his willingness to take risks and challenge expectations.

The act of burning his guitar also had a spiritual element for Hendrix. He believed in the power of music to transcend boundaries and connect people on a deeper level. By sacrificing his guitar, he was tapping into a primal energy that went beyond words or notes, a way to communicate with his audience on a visceral level.
